Flange Bearing
One can find flange bearing with many of the distributors of bearings in the market. For instance the SKF bearing have Flanged bearings. They produce such bearing in stainless steel. There are deep groves in the external flange of the outer ring of such bearing. This type of flange within the bearings enabled it to be axially located. The design might sound complex but is actually very simple. With the help of flange bearings, it is possible to save space.
In flange bearing housing shoulders are not required. Hence the housing ore need not be something very expensive. Available from SKF is flanged bearings of stainless steel with open design and shielded one as well as z shield on both sides. Internal designs of such bearings are the same. In fact the cage design is also similar. It has some resemblance to those which are without flange. In such bearings, it is possible to accommodate some loan and operate them at the same speed as is required. The grease which is used in the shield bearings which have flange is same as that of the ordinary bearing.
There are available simple flange bearing as well as two bolt flange bearing. In vehicles where there are huge loadings, such bearings are very essential.
